[23]
LC
Late Collision
The LC indicates the collision found in the outside of 64 bytes collision window. This
means after the 64 bytes of a frame has been transmitted out to the network, the collision
still found. The late collision check will only be done while EMAC is operating on half-
duplex mode.
0 = No collision found in the outside of 64 bytes collision window.
1 = Collision found in the outside of 64 bytes collision window.
[22]
TXABT
Transmission Abort
The TXABT indicates the packet incurred 16 consecutive collisions during transmission,
and then the transmission process for this packet is aborted. The transmission abort is
only available while EMAC is operating on half-duplex mode.
0 = Packet does not incur 16 consecutive collisions during transmission.
1 = Packet incurred 16 consecutive collisions during transmission.
[21]
NCS
No Carrier Sense
The NCS indicates the MII I/F signal CRS does not active at the start of or during the
packet transmission. The NCS is only available while EMAC is operating on half-duplex
mode.
0 = CRS signal does not active at the start of or during the packet transmission.
1 = CRS signal actives correctly.
[20]
EXDEF
Defer Exceed
The EXDEF indicates the frame waiting for transmission has deferred over 0.32768ms on
100Mbps mode, or 3.2768ms on 10Mbps mode. The deferral exceed check will only be
done while bit NDEF of MCMDR is disabled, and EMAC is operating on half-duplex
mode.
0 = Frame waiting for transmission did not defer over 0.32768ms (100Mbps) or 3.2768ms
(10Mbps).
1 = Frame waiting for transmission deferred over 0.32768ms (100Mbps) or 3.2768ms
(10Mbps).
[19]
TXCP
Transmission Complete
The TXCP indicates the packet transmission has completed correctly.
0 = The packet transmission does not complete.
1 = The packet transmission completed.
[18]
Reserved
Reserved.
[17]
DEF
Transmission Deferred
The DEF indicates the packet transmission has deferred once. The DEF is only available
while EMAC is operating on half-duplex mode.
0 = Packet transmission does not defer.
1 = Packet transmission deferred once.
[16]
TXINTR
Transmit Interrupt
The TXINTR indicates the packet transmission would trigger an interrupt condition.
0 = The packet transmission would not trigger an interrupt.
1 = The packet transmission would trigger an interrupt.
[15:0]
TBC
Transmit Byte Count
The TBC indicates the byte count of the frame stored in the data buffer pointed by TX
descriptor for transmission.
